Can I use the headphone jack on my iMac to connect speakers?
I want to watch a surround sound movie, can I use external speakers using the headphone jack?

It is analog speakers which connect to the earphone jack. Digital speakers are either USB or Bluetooth.
I haven't tested this myself but as long as the analog speakers have an external power supply to the speaker amplifier I can't see why it shouldn't work. I used that system on my old Mac Pro. Set it up with the iMac volume set to 50% and adjust the output on the speakers .

The headphone jack is stereo, not surround sound. Plugging into the headphone jack also turns off the built-in speakers.
